PostalDataPI is a global postal code validation and enrichment API covering 240+ countries and territories. One API, one key, one flat rate โ $0.000028 per query with no tiers or subscriptions.
What you get back: Up to 18 metadata fields per postal code โ city, state/region, coordinates, timezone, three levels of administrative hierarchy, elevation, and more. Sub-5ms cached responses.
Works everywhere: US ZIP codes, UK postcodes, German PLZ, Japanese postal codes, Canadian FSAs, and 230+ more. Format normalization handles case, spacing, and hyphen variations automatically.
